Therapeutic Approaches and Online Care

Dr. Susan Murati draws on evidence-informed approaches that translate well to online formats.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) helps people clarify their values, accept difficult thoughts or feelings, and take actions that align with what matters most - it is useful for anxiety, depression, and life transitions. Client-Centered Therapy emphasizes empathy, active listening, and unconditional regard so clients feel understood and supported while they explore their goals and identity.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) focuses on identifying unhelpful thought and behavior patterns and developing practical skills to reduce symptoms and improve daily functioning, making it effective for anxiety, depression, and coping with stress.

Finding the right approach is part of the work. Dr. Susan Murati collaborates with each person to determine which methods fit their needs, goals, and preferences, and she adjusts strategies over time as progress and challenges emerge.
